Understanding Assisted Living: What It Is and Who It's For



Assisted living represents an important bridge for people seeking support while keeping a degree of self-reliance. This choice provides to older grownups or those with impairments who call for support with day-to-day tasks such as showering, clothing, and medication management. Unlike retirement home, assisted living facilities provide an even more home-like atmosphere, allowing residents to involve in social activities, seek hobbies, and take pleasure in common dining. Citizens normally have semi-private or personal space, promoting a feeling of freedom. The staff is trained to give individualized care customized per person's requirements, guaranteeing safety and comfort. Overall, assisted living acts as a practical service for those who desire to protect their self-reliance while obtaining required assistance in a supportive area.

Just how can family members and people navigate the myriad choices offered in assisted living centers? Comprehending the kinds of centers is necessary for making informed decisions. Assisted living options typically consist of traditional assisted living areas, which provide assistance with everyday tasks, and memory treatment centers, especially developed for individuals with Alzheimer's or dementia. There are additionally independent living areas, providing an extra autonomous way of life with very little assistance, and proceeding care retirement neighborhoods, which give a series of services from independent living to experienced nursing treatment as requirements change - Assisted Living Charlotte. Each kind varies relating to services, facilities, and environment, allowing family members to choose a center that aligns with the certain needs and choices of their enjoyed ones. Safety and Security Measures



Prioritizing safety and security is important for families taking into consideration assisted living communities for their loved ones. Trick features to review consist of secure entry points, such as keycard access or checked entrances, which assist protect against unauthorized access. In addition, neighborhoods need to supply 24/7 personnel availability to react to emergency situations and supply assurance. Security video cameras alike locations can enhance security while making certain citizens feel comfortable. Fire safety procedures, including lawn sprinklers and alarm systems, are likewise crucial. In addition, specific home features like grab bars and emergency phone call systems promote independence while ensuring prompt aid if needed. Reviewing these safety and security steps can considerably influence a household's choice concerning an ideal assisted living neighborhood for their loved ones.

Transitioning to Assisted Living: Tips for a Smooth Relocate



As households plan for a loved one's change to assisted living, it is necessary to come close to the relocation with cautious planning and empathy. Initially, entailing the individual in the decision-making procedure promotes a sense of control and convenience. Families ought to visit prospective facilities together, permitting the enjoyed one to express choices. Developing a personal area within the new setting can alleviate the change; bringing acquainted things from home-- like images, blankets, or preferred books-- can give confidence. Additionally, developing a routine can assist the individual adapt to the brand-new surroundings. Households ought to likewise maintain open lines of interaction, urging gos to and normal check-ins to assure their loved one that they remain an integral part of domesticity.
